Get in on the conversation with hosts David C. Gross and Tomaso Semioli! These veteran journalists / musicians / authors delve into the lives and careers of senior and approaching senior artists who continue to thrive in various musical genres spanning rock, jazz, blues, folk, Avant Garde, experimental, classical, and permutations thereof. What is Notes From An Artist about and what kind of topics does it cover?

A compelling exploration of the music industry through engaging conversations, featuring seasoned artists and musicians who continue to make waves in various genres including rock, jazz, blues, and classical. The hosts showcase a blend of interviews and thematic playlists, creating a rich auditory experience that reflects the depth and breadth of musical expression. Topics often encompass personal anecdotes from artists' careers, insights into music history, and discussions of cultural influences, making it a unique resource for music lovers and industry professionals alike.
